Johnstown Opens Applications for Data Center Advisory Committee

The Town of Johnstown is accepting applications from residents interested in serving on a new committee that will study data-center development and recommend possible policies to the Town Council.

The seven-member Data Center Advisory Committee will review information about data centers, consider community concerns and develop recommendations for elected officials. The committee will not approve or deny development applications, and final policy decisions will remain with the Town Council.

The Town Council created the committee on July 20 as Johnstown considers how data centers should be addressed in its land-use regulations. One Town staff member will provide administrative support, while the appointed members will be residents.

The Town says it intends to select a balanced group of residents willing to engage constructively with the issue. Committee members are expected to review information, consider different community perspectives and help develop recommendations for the Council.

The application period comes as Johnstown begins work under a temporary moratorium on new data-center facilities. The moratorium prevents the Town from accepting applications or conducting pre-submittal activities while officials study potential regulations.

The moratorium could end sooner if the Town adopts definitions, development standards and other regulations governing the facilities. The temporary pause is intended to give Johnstown time to examine issues such as water and electricity demand, infrastructure, noise, emergency-service needs and compatibility with surrounding land uses.

The initial application period is expected to remain open for about two weeks, although the Town has not announced a specific closing date. Staff will review the applications and recommend residents for appointment.
